Launching Your Business in the USA: A Step-by-Step Guide

Pursue your entrepreneurial dreams by registering your business in the United States. This process may require several key steps to ensure legal compliance and smooth operation. First, you'll need to select a suitable business structure, such as a sole proprietorship, partnership, LLC, or corporation. Each structure features different legal and tax implications, so it's crucial to investigate your options carefully. Once you've pinpointed the ideal structure, you'll need to file articles of incorporation or organization with your state government. This document details the mission of your business and provides essential information about its ownership and operations.

After filing your documents, you may need to obtain several licenses and permits depending on your industry and location. Check with your state and local authorities to meet all regulatory requirements. Finally, set up a business bank account to distinguish your personal 报税 and business finances. This practice promotes good financial management and simplifies tax preparation.

By following these steps, you can efficiently register your business in the USA and lay a solid foundation for growth and success.

Navigating US Company Tax Filing: Everything You Need to Know

Filing your company's taxes can seem daunting, but that doesn't have to be the case. With a little planning, you can make the process manageable. First and foremost, determine which forms your company needs to file based on its type.

,Frequently used forms include Form 1040 for sole proprietorships, Form 1120 for corporations, and Form 1065 for partnerships. ,After that, gather all the necessary financial records, such as income statements, balance sheets, and expense reports. Be prepared to provide documentation for any deductions you're claiming.

It strongly recommend consulting with a qualified tax professional who can guide you through the specific requirements of your circumstances. They can help confirm that you file accurately and maximize any available savings.

Submitting your company's taxes on time is crucial to escape penalties. The IRS provides various resources, including online tools and publications, to help businesses with the filing process.

Creating Your Dream Business: Registering an American Corporation

Embarking on the entrepreneurial journey is an exciting endeavor. For maximum this goal, a crucial first step is to registering your business as an American corporation. This legal structure offers several benefits, including limited liability protection and legal advantages. The process of incorporation can seem daunting, but by following the necessary steps, you can smoothly navigate this procedure.

  • , Begin by choosing a unique name for your corporation. It should be distinct from existing businesses and comply with state naming regulations.
  • Next file the necessary documents with the Secretary of State's office in your chosen state of incorporation. This typically includes articles of incorporation, which outline the purpose and structure of your corporation.
  • Once filing, you will receive a certificate of incorporation, officially validating your business as a legal entity.

Remember to consult with a business professional for personalized guidance throughout the process. They can help guarantee that you meet all requirements and navigate any complex regulations.
